Output 66a40953d9c2b99bd91ee70f478863abc1feeb1c7c4120af4c82c17912f1de81:0

value
2125100
script pubkey
OP_0 OP_PUSHBYTES_20 c23a9dba8cf6aa9ed0e585adde6d80096f7dbfe4
address
bc1qcgafmw5v764fa589skkaumvqp9hhm0lyujjggy
transaction
66a40953d9c2b99bd91ee70f478863abc1feeb1c7c4120af4c82c17912f1de81
spent
true